Henderson House high quality supported living accommodation From Superman to Super Homes – a new model for supported living On 18th October 2019 we were delighted to host the official opening of Henderson House, our latest supported living project in Croydon. Henderson House is a block of 10 beautiful, self-contained apartments with a community space...Continue Reading